This manual begins with a table that lists interactive optimizer commands in alphabetic order with their primary options. Languages and apis this part of the manual collects topics about each of the application programming interfaces apis available for ibm ilog cplex. Welcome to the ibm ilog cplex optimization studio documentation. Cutting stock problem rolls there is a supply of rolls of material of fixed length the stock. Ibm ilog cplex states these additional registered trademarks, s, and. By default, cplex as gurobi, matlab and others do will use all cpus and cores of the machine on which the program runs. Ilog cplex 05 iran university of science and technology.
Ibm ilog cplex states these additional registered trademarks and acknowledgements. It also contains a chapter describing the equivalent commands for the cplex interactive base system. Ilog cplex can optimize such problems as ordinary linear programs, but if ilog cplex can extract all or part of the problem as a network, then it will apply its more efficient network optimizer to that part of your problem and use the partial solution it finds there to construct an advanced starting point to optimize the rest of the problem. In this tutorial i will describe how to download and install a full version of ibm ilog cplex optimization studio 12. Introducing ibm ilog cplex optimization studio v12.
For detailed instructions on using cplex from ampl, including a complete listing of cplex options and. Ibm ilog cplex optimization studio provides the most efficient way of building models for mathematical programming, constraint programming and constraintbased scheduling, in order to tackle complex optimization problems such as planning and scheduling. Ilog cplex 04 iran university of science and technology. Cplex optimization studio ce ibm decision optimization. The user code accesses the variable only through its concert technology interface. Downloading ibm ilog cplex optimization studio v12. This manual lists these parameters and explains their settings in the cplex component libraries and the interactive op timizer. Concert technology offers the same functionality now for mip starts as for. Detailed instructions for downloading the product from the ibm passport advantage website are available below. Older versions of the cplex solver for ampl were simply named cplex cplex.
In 2004, the work on cplex earned the first informs impact prize. Ilog cplex is a tool for solving linear optimization problems, commonly referred to as linear programming lp problems, of the form. Package cplexapi june 21, 2019 type package title r interface to c api of ibm ilog cplex version 1. Optimizer options this manual explains how to use the lp algorithms that are part of ilog cplex. It contains instructions for installing ilog cplex. I am using the ibm ilog cplex optimization studio version 12. It is not necessary to read each of these topics thoroughly. The qp, qcp, and mip problemtypes are based on the lp concepts discussed here, and the extensions to build and solve such problems are explained in the ilog cplex users. Cplex indicates the cplex prompt, and text following this prompt is user input. Ibm ilog cplex states these additional registered trademarks, s, and acknowledgements. Web sites there are two kinds of web pages available to users of concert technology. For some commands, it also tells where examples of their use can be found in the ilog cplex users manual or getting started.
Ibm ilog cplex optimization studio cplexusersmanual. Managing parameters in the interactive optimizer on page 17. Patterns ilog cplex all the strips cut from one roll are known together as a. In other words, i want all possible solutions which. Quick start to ibm ilog optimization products appendix a. For detailed instructions on using cplex from ampl, including a complete listing of cplex options and directives, consult the ilog ampl cplex system version 8. Ibm ilog cplex optimization studio free version download. Ibm ilog cplex states these additional r egister ed trademarks, s, and acknowledgements. Meet cplex introduces cplex, explains what it does, suggests prerequisites, and offers advice for using this documentation with it. Ilog cplex is a shareware software in the category miscellaneous developed by ilog s.
Patterns ilog cplex all the strips cut from one roll are known together. Languages and apis this part of the manual collects topics about each of. Highlights provides high performance and scalability develops and deploys new optimizationbased models makes a difference with realworld applications. Ibm, the ibm logo, websphere, ilog, the ilog design, and cplex are.
Ibm gives scholars and university researchers free access to its software and systems. You could access below cplex user manual which tells how to enumerate all. The qp, qcp, and mip problem types are based on the lp concepts discussed here, and the extensions to build and solve such problems are explained in the ilog cplex users manual. This book includes a tutorial on ampl and optimization modeling. Cplex java applications similarly, all other modeling objects are accessed only through their respective concert. Cplex setting up guide, which contains instructions for installing, licensing, compiling and linking cplex getting. Ibm ilog cplex optimization studio free version download for pc. In this test the linear sos1 constraints are defined explicitly. Contains the release notes for ibm ilog cplex optimization studio v12. If a user provides a mip start full or partial that cannot be extended into a feasible solution, ilog cplex will try to repair it. This manual lists these parameters and explains their settings in the ilog cplex component libraries and the interactive optimizer. Txt the notes on using cplex with ampl provided by ampl optimization llc ampl. Ibm ilog cplex optimization studio often informally referred to simply as cplex is an optimization software package. Ibm ilog cplex optimization studio for multiplatforms version 12.
Ilog concert solvers cplex mathematical programming lp, qp, milp, miqp cp constraint programming a common way to define the model concert environment. To download cplex optimization studio, click on view all my downloads and search for eassembly ibm ilog cplex optimization studio, if necessary. Installed files unix systems windows systems examples amplcplexuserguide122. Cosc 480math 482 cplex installation and usage guide. Ilog cplex is a tool for solving linear optimization problems, commonly referred to as linear programming. Mar 30, 2020 work with cplex and cp optimizer solvers and improve decision making in your business by performing statistical analysis and data management. Chapter 12, solving problems with quadratic constraints qcp, introduces problems. For some commands, it also tells where examples of their use can be found in the. May 24, 2015 in this tutorial i will describe how to download and install a full version of ibm ilog cplex optimization studio 12. For example, you could end mipopt after a certain number of nodes, go off and compute a solution on your own, and then give that solution to ilog cplex and continue optimizing with another call to mipopt. Cplex java applications similarly, all other modeling objects are accessed only through their respective concert technology interfaces from the userwritten application, while the actual objects are maintained in the ilog cplex database. Probably i am not the first one to report this but cplex is now available for free for academics as part of ibms academic initiative see here.
Introduction provides an overview of ibm ilog cplex optimization studio. This support to our academic research is greatly appreciated. End of support for ilog cplex optimization studio 12. Description running a generalized assignment problem gap from wolsey 1, 9. Ibm ilog cplex optimization studio provides the most efficient way of building models for mathematical programming, constraint programming and constraintbased scheduling, in order to. Table 1 lists the examples in this manual and indicates where to find them. Work with cplex and cp optimizer solvers and improve decision making in your business by performing statistical analysis and data management. Cplex installation and usage guide september 24, 2012 for mac. Cplex free for academic use sebastian pokuttas blog. The qp, qcp, and mip problem types are based on the lp.
Ilog cplex can optimize such problems as ordinary linear programs, but if ilog cplex can extract all or part of the problem as a network, then it will apply its more efficient network optimizer to that part of. This preface introduces the ilog cplex users manual. Ibm ilog cplex optimizer gives developers a variety of ways to interact with it during the development and deployment of their applications. Installing products from ibm ilog optimization suite for academic initiative v2. Since the problem is so big, cplex takes a very long time, so i want to limit the runtime. Worlds most trusted solver ibm ilog cplex easily embed analytical capabilities within your decision support applications smarter decisions through applied.
For the examples explained in the manual, you will find the complete code for the solution in the examples subdirectory of the standard distribution of ilog cplex, so that you can see exactly how ilog cplex fits into your own applications. If you do the latter, you must remember to copy it again the next time you upgrade cplexamp. This version of ampl will use this solver by default. We encourage you to use email for faster, better service. As your constraints 2 and 3 are literally the same besides a missing space and a different letter oz i guess cplex comes up with the easiest solution by assigning the same values to all decision variables. To limit the number if threads used by cplex, we ask you to use.
874 301 1208 1502 1454 136 1568 593 574 1159 1549 322 1231 39 1171 219 1412 753 109 863 960 1375 727 433 1448 257 1482 1187 124 809 608 541 395 17 1062 978 1246 152 110 531 377 974 405 169 438